9 11 Remembrance and CBC Policy Shift | Wilmington News
As the U.S. marks 25 years since 9/11 alongside its 250th birthday, officials push to educate younger generations on the event’s gravity and national response. Meanwhile, Canada’s CBC reverses course after backlash over a memo urging reporters to avoid calling the attacks “terrorist attacks,” reaffirming it will now label them as such without needing direct attribution. Complicating legal proceedings, a military judge has dismissed a key confession from Khalid Sheikh Mohammed, delaying his trial with co-defendants until June 28, 2024.
